The West Essex Chapter of the AARP holds a candidates forum today at 1 pm and plans to put local candidates for House and Senate on the spot on the issues of Social Security and Medicare. Planning to attend: Congressman Bill Pascrell, his Republican opponent Jose Sandoval and Republican Senate challenger Tom Kean Jr. Senator Bob Menendez is not expected to be there.
The event will be at the United Way building, 60 South Fullerton Ave., Montclair.
